We are seeking an experienced and commercially astute Raw Materials Buyer to source, negotiate, and secure high-quality raw materials essential to our forging operations - including metal billets, ingots and bar stock. You will play a key role in ensuring continuity of supply, cost competitiveness, and adherence to technical specifications. Working closely with Commercial, Quality Engineering, Inventory Control and Planning, you will help maintain optimal inventory levels and support smooth, efficient operational performance.
Main duties of the role include:
Procurement & Sourcing - Source and purchase forging-grade metals, develop an effective sourcing strategy, evaluate and audit suppliers, and monitor global metal markets to maintain quality, reliability, and competitive pricing.
Negotiation & Contract Management – Negotiate pricing, payment terms, deliveries and long-term supply agreements; ensure contracts meet technical and certification requirements; and issue purchase orders while maintaining accurate procurement records.
Technical & Quality Alignment – Collaborate with Quality and Production to ensure materials meet forging specifications, review mill certifications and MTRs, and resolve any material-related issues promptly.
Inventory & Supply Continuity – Work with Planning, Production, and Commercial teams to maintain inventory, mitigate supply risks, and coordinate efficient inbound deliveries.
Cost & Performance Analysis – Monitor procurement KPIs, analyse cost drivers, and support budgeting and cost-reduction initiatives.
Compliance & Documentation – Ensure compliance with industry standards, maintain procurement and supplier records, and uphold ethical sourcing and corporate policies.

About Independent Forgings
Independent Forgings and Alloys (IFA) is one of Britain’s leading independent aerospace and industrial forgers. The unique feature about IFA is the combination of open and closed-die forging while also undertaking the whole production process from raw material to the finished product in one location. Operating from a 680 000ft2 facility in Sheffield, we manufacture high-integrity, open-die and closed-die forged components in nickel alloy, titanium, stainless steel and carbon alloys for customers and tier-one suppliers within the aerospace, nuclear, power generation, marine as well as oil and gas sector.
